Ok, i bought one of those silicone pearl molds. I have been trying to get a strand of pearls out of it but i have not quite got the hang of it. Does anyone know exactly how to use this? The instructions that came with it were not very clear. Thank you for any help!

I have some of the molds. This is what I do to make the strands. I dust the inside of the mold with my pearl dust then I open it all the way and push it, while holding it open, down onto a roll of fondant. I then take my fingers and push down on the mold even more to make sure all the holes are filled. Then with firm pressure I flatten out the mold (still face down) and I move my fingers to the long sides of it and squeeze it closed. I cut off any fondant sticking out the shorter sides and scrape off any fondant that was pinched out of the opening. Then I open it and I hold it at a slant and sometimes the strand will come out on its own or I have to give it a start with a toothpick or something. I start with the end closest to my work surface. Just be careful to not leave any indentations or break off any beads when loosening. The key is to make sure you get enough fondant into the mold and let the mold squeeze out any excess. If you don't have enough fondant then your pearls will all fall off individually.
